| Getting the Service You are Paying For |
Service Level Management is a continuous improvement process designed to improve IT service quality by developing, monitoring and reporting on internal and external service agreements.
The time spent in establishing a detailed understanding between a supplier and a user can avoid huge problems later. Not all services are delivered consistently, over a long time period. Not all users can say that their requirements haven’t changed. Not all suppliers are eager to accept change requirements. Service Level Management addresses these issues with practical cost-effective solutions. |

Common Industry Problems
Service delivery, whether internal or external, should have an agreement between the provider and the recipient. - “Gentlemen’s agreements” do not cover situations where service requirements are not met.
- User expectations are not met by supplier’s capability.
- Exceptional events create unforeseen changes in service levels that require new service levels.
- Changes in staffing bring changes in the service levels and if there are no agreements in place service levels deteriorate.
Changing service level agreements is difficult if a change mechanism isn’t negotiated as part of the agreement. |

A typical Service Level Agreement should describe: - The services between the parties and related payments
- The levels of service to be delivered (e.g. response time, turnaround times, volumes)
- How the service levels will be measured
- How inadequate service levels will be rectified and/or compensated.
- How changes will be addressed.
